Arianna's service charge at the beauty salon was $82.50 before tax. The sales tax rate was 8%. If she added 20% of the amount before tax as a tip, how much did she pay for the service at the salon?​

Answer:

$105.60

Step-by-step explanation:

8% of $82.50 is $6.60

20% of $82.50 is $16.50

$82.50 + $6.60 + $16.50 = $105.60
